Something similar to this might have happened:

Some 12 years ago the Vanguard broke the news of Dr Abalaka’s cure for HIV/AIDS. Immediately the Nigerian intelligentsia and educated elite, a band of cynics, claimed it was no cure; Abalaka, they insisted, was a babalawo, not an educated man – his name suggested it. Quickly, Abalaka was on the TV showing his University of Jos MBBS certificate. They argued, that Abalaka was a doctor didn’t mean he should also involve in medical research; there was a rule to this thing. Again, Abalaka brought another certificate of his PG trainings in one-thing-one-thing. They insisted Abalaka must show prove of whom he had cured. A Nigerian colonel said it was true – 400 of his men back from ECOMOG in Liberia have been cured.

Then the Minister of Health, a man named Tim Menekaya, who was in his sixties but carried the face of a man in his nineties, got real angry. He said the colonel had no right to speak on such matters – and the military hierarchy agreed their colonel spoke out of order. Menekaya advised Abalaka to stop going to the press; convention demands that he, Abalaka, publish his findings first in a medical journal. Doesn’t Abalaka know that educated people don’t announce inventions on the pages of newspaper, he asked. The Nigerian journalists, now behind Abalaka, countered that even the discoverers of the virus, Robert Gallo and Montaigne, also went first to the press.

Abalaka , thoroughly satisfied with this support, gathered the journalists to his Abuja office and, in their presence, vaccinated himself (ingested HIV into his blood). People danced on the streets of Abuja. One journalist said he was leaving for Europe to personally nominate Abalaka for the Nobel.

Then tragedy happened; Abalaka’s wife died. Every Nigerian, including those who have promised to nominate him, ran away. They said the poor woman died of the HIV the husband had ingested. Abalaka struggled to convince Nigerians that his wife died of liver problem. Nigerians said, a man who can cure AIDS should be able to handle ordinary liver damage. Abalaka was no longer a hero but an insane man who self-infected himself with the deadly virus.

Abalaka, an ambitious man, fought not to go down. He would show Nigerians that he was a great man. He went and collected PDP governorship primaries form and, in his first public outing, promised his people of Kogi State and the neighbouring Benue that he would build a hospital at the boundary and cure their AIDS freely. (Benue State is to Nigeria what South Africa is to Africa with regards to AIDS prevalence).

Before Abalaka could submit his form, three men from NAFDAC (the government agency regulating canned food, bottled drinks, biscuits and pharmaceutical products) arrived his Okene village from Lagos and requested he joined them to Lagos. Abalaka felt God has heard his prayers; PDP was going to provide money through NAFDAC to help him win the election.

At Lagos things took a strange dimension. They took off Abalaka’s belt and tie – so that he would not hurt himself. Then when Abalaka realised what was happening, they took his phone; he couldn’t reach Femi Falana, Bamidele Aturu or Festus Keyamo or even his family. The NAFDAC people accused him of defaulting to pay patent fees of [N3000] for his findings!

Abalaka requested they should take him to his bank and he would pay, even though it was no criminal offence requiring arrest. They told Abalaka that they were making their investigations. The investigation took quite long, ran into days. By the time Abalaka was found not guilty and released, the PDP governorship primary was over.

I was in Abuja when Abalaka appeared on the TV. He had become thin and his voice was no longer that of a discoverer but of a man just evicted from 1009. The host asked if he would take PDP to the tribunal. Abalaka replied, he had left it in the hands of God. The host asked if he would sue NAFDAC for illegal detention. Abalaka replied, he had left the matter in the hands of God. The host asked if he was going to research another sickness, say, sickle cell anaemia. Abalaka said, he had left E.V.E.R.Y.T.H.I.N.G in the hands of God

I believe this is more of a political issue that may not have involved any level of external pressure. Prof. Ibeh is presently the Dean of the College of Medicine, UNIBEN. If I remember clearly about 4years ago this particular college had accreditation issues, that was resolved in a political settlement. If the same College is coming out to say they found a cure for AIDS, this would put them on the spotlight(nationally and globally).The standard of the College may be brought under scrutiny and would bring about negative publicity than positive publicity. I believe the denouncing of the claims by the College and the later statement of Prof. Ibeh is more of an act of damage control.If you notice, the press statement of the University distancing itself from the claims is coming from the Provost of the College of Medicine, and not the Vice-Chancellor.
